Kidney nerve ablation to treat hard-to-control blood pressure

Hypertension

Part of Heart & circulation clinical trials.

This trial tests a procedure that targets nerves near the kidney (renal denervation) to help lower blood pressure in people whose hypertension is not controlled despite medication. It uses a special 3D mapping system to guide the procedure.

Who can take part

  • You’re between 18 and 70 years old, and you can’t be pregnant or planning pregnancy in the next year
  • You have high blood pressure that is essential (not caused by another disease), and you either can’t tolerate medicines or they’re not controlling it
  • Your 24-hour blood pressure is high (average top number at least 130, or daytime at least 135) and your pulse pressure difference is under 80
  • In the last 6 months, you used blood pressure medicines, and before enrollment you took a standardized plan with at least two drugs for at least 28 days with at least 80% adherence
  • Your kidneys are functioning enough (eGFR at least 45) and you’re okay to undergo the surgical kidney procedure
